Western Union Launches Visa Stablecard Powered by Rain

(5 August 2026 – Global) Western Union and Rain have launched Stablecard, a digital wallet and USDPT-backed Visa secured credit card designed to enable clients to hold, move and spend US Dollar (USD) value globally.

Stablecard offers a consumer-friendly way to receive funds and store value in USDPT, a USD stablecoin, in a secure digital wallet and spend seamlessly anywhere Visa is accepted. USDPT is issued by Anchorage Digital Bank on the Solana blockchain. USDPT is redeemable 1:1 for USD and is fully backed by reserves.

Stablecard goes live in 37 markets, including key markets where local currency is not stable and demand for stablecoins is already visible, with Western Union targeting 60 plus markets by the end of the year.
